Description
You are the child of famed adventurers Garic and Illyana Stoutshield. Sadly, they disappeared while hunting down a band of monsters near your village (perhaps they were rusty after a couple years of retirement?). You were subsequently reared by their friends and former adventuring colleagues, Gringus and Lorena Kneecapper. On a farm in the border town of Daelen's grove (on the edge of the Moravian Empire), you were taught how to farm, milk cows, gather eggs, hunt boar, hide in shadows, use all manner of weaponry, handle powerful magics, etc. Y'know, the basic things most farmers need to know if they plan on going out and laying waste to the goblin hordes. Today is your birthday, and not just any birthday. No, today is the day you come of age. It's very exciting. All you have to do is complete a few chores and get your birthday presents, then maybe hear a family secret or two...assuming all hell doesn't break loose first, but that'll NEVER happen.

2004-03-10DetroitDog6.56Paranoia is refreshingly out of the ordinary. The author has an excellent command of the toolset and shows a high level of proficiency. The story is dynamic, with drama, suspense and humor interspersed throughout. Some of the scripting is downright ingenious.The merits of this module really do outweigh the shortcomings and it is recommended for those who wish to experience an innovative and captivating journey.

Posted by Schler ( ..xxx.xxx ) at 2004-03-31 10:31:00    
Nice mod, though it had a few bugs:

## POSSIBLE SPOILERS ##

I was invulnerable after the fight with the barbarian, but with some commands I turned me back to normal (I think dm_god 0 helped).

I had killed the hopgoblin chief before I met the barbarians and already sold the shield to the merchant when I got the mission to kill the hopgoblins again. But after buying back the shield it wouldn't be recognized by the barbarian chief.

The orc quest was quite easy since none of them sounded an alarm. I wasn't trying to hide though, but went right in for the killing. From what I read below I'm not sure it's supposed to be like that.

After the dream-sequence I get the same dialog from Doric as before. Only when I decline to go on the mission again and leave his hut an assassin shows up.

When I killed the assassins on the way to the village (just before the end of the module) Doric shows up again to tell me the same stuff he already told me in the barbarian village.

The quest with the crypt is not solved after killing the bad guy at the second level (very tough fight!!!). I don't know if there is something else to do or if it's a bug.
And you can get more than one amulet from the grave: Just drop it and search the grave again.

The henchman AI is worse than normal: The barbarian always switched to his bow (even in melee), although I told him to use his axe.
